中图网文创礼盒,买2个减5元
欢迎光临中图网 请 | 注册
> >>
数据库系统原理与应用技术

数据库系统原理与应用技术

作者:陈漫红
出版社:机械工业出版社出版时间:2010-03-01
开本: 16开 页数: 388
中 图 价:¥17.2(4.3折) 定价  ¥40.0 登录后可看到会员价
暂时缺货 收藏
运费6元,满69元免运费
?快递不能达地区使用邮政小包,运费14元起
云南、广西、海南、新疆、青海、西藏六省,部分地区快递不可达
温馨提示:5折以下图书主要为出版社尾货,大部分为全新(有塑封/无塑封),个别图书品相8-9成新、切口
有划线标记、光盘等附件不全详细品相说明>>
本类五星书更多>

数据库系统原理与应用技术 版权信息

数据库系统原理与应用技术 内容简介

本书是面向计算机及相关专业学生学习数据库知识而编写的教材,其中既包括数据库的基础理论知识,又包括数据库前端和后端的应用技术。本书由三部分组成:**部分介绍数据库系统原理;第二部分介绍sql server 2005数据库系统基础与使用;第三部分介绍用vb和asp.net开发数据库应用程序。本书每章后配有习题,并在书后给出参考答案。为便于教师教学,本教材还配有电子课件。
  本书内容全面,使数据库的理论充分地与sql server 2005数据库系统实际应用相结合,实用性强,所有实例都经过上机实践通过,可操作性强。
  本书可作为普通高等院校计算机及其相关专业数据库原理课程的教材,也可供计算机爱好者及技术人员的自学参考书。

数据库系统原理与应用技术 目录

出版说明
前言
**部分 数据库系统原理
 第1章 数据库系统概论
  1.1 引言
   1.1.1 数据、信息及知识三者的关系
   1.1.2 数据处理
   1.1.3 以数据为中心的应用系统的特点
  1.2 数据库和数据库系统的发展
   1.2.1 数据管理的发展
   1.2.2 数据库系统产生的背景
   1.2.3 数据库系统的应用前景
  1.3 数据库管理系统
   1.3.1 数据库管理系统的主要功能
   1.3.2 数据库管理系统的组成
  1.4 小结
  1.5 习题
 第2章 数据库系统的结构
  2.1 现实世界的数据描述
   2.1.1 数据描述
   2.1.2 数据模型
  2.2 概念数据模型
   2.2.1 基本概念
   2.2.2 实体-联系模型
  2.3 结构数据模型
   2.3.1 层次数据模型
   2.3.2 网状数据模型
   2.3.3 关系数据模型
  2.4 数据库系统的组成与结构
   2.4.1 数据库系统的组成
   2.4.2 三级模式结构
   2.4.3 二级映像
   2.4.4 数据独立性
   2.4.5 数据库管理系统的存取过程及数据库系统的特点
  2.5 小结
  2.6 习题
 第3章 关系数据库理论基础
  3.1 关系模型概述
   3.1.1 关系数据结构
   3.1.2 关系操作
   3.1.3 数据完整性约束
  3.2 关系数据模型的形式化定义
  3.3 关系模式与关系数据库
   3.3.1 关系模式
   3.3.2 关系数据库
  3.4 关系模型的完整性约束
   3.4.1 实体完整性
   3.4.2 参照完整性
   3.4.3 用户定义完整性
  3.5 关系代数
   3.5.1 关系代数运算
   3.5.2 传统的集合运算
   3.5.3 专门的关系运算
  3.6 小结
  3.7 习题
 第4章 关系数据库标准语言sql
  4.1 sql语言概述
   4.1.1 sql语言的特点
   4.1.2 sql对关系数据库模式的支持
  4.2 sql的数据类型
  4.3 sql的数据定义功能
   4.3.1 定义基本表结构
   4.3.2 修改基本表
   4.3.3 删除基本表
  4.4 sql的查询语句
   4.4.1 单表查询
   4.4.2 多表连接查询
   4.4.3 子查询
  4.5 sql的数据操纵功能
   4.5.1 插入(insert)数据
   4.5.2 更新(update)数据
   4.5.3 删除(delete)数据
  4.6 建立和删除索引
   4.6.1 索引的概念
   4.6.2 建立索引
   4.6.3 删除索引
  4.7 sql的控制功能
   4.7.1 授权
   4.7.2 收回权限
   4.7.3 拒绝权限
  4.8 小结
  4.9 习题
 第5章 数据库规范化理论
 第6章 数据库保护
 第7章 数据库设计
第二部分 sql server 2005数据库系统基础与使用
 第8章 sql server 2005概述
 第9章 数据库操作
 第10章 基本表的创建与管理
 第11章 视图、存储过程和触发器的建立和使用
 第12章 安全管理
 第13章 数据库日常维护
第三部分 开发数据库应用程序
 第14章 用vb进行c/s结构数据库应用程序开发
 第15章 用asp.net进行web数据库开发
参考答案
参考文献
展开全部

数据库系统原理与应用技术 节选

《数据库系统原理与应用技术》是面向计算机及相关专业学生学习数据库知识而编写的教材,其中既包括数据库的基础理论知识,又包括数据库前端和后端的应用技术。《数据库系统原理与应用技术》由三部分组成:**部分介绍数据库系统原理;第二部分介绍SQL Server 2005数据库系统基础与使用;第三部分介绍用VB和ASP.NET开发数据库应用程序。《数据库系统原理与应用技术》每章后配有习题,并在书后给出参考答案。为便于教师教学,本教材还配有电子课件。《数据库系统原理与应用技术》内容全面,使数据库的理论充分地与SQL Server 2005数据库系统实际应用相结合,实用性强,所有实例都经过上机实践通过,可操作性强。《数据库系统原理与应用技术》可作为普通高等院校计算机及其相关专业数据库原理课程的教材,也可供计算机爱好者及技术人员的自学参考书。

数据库系统原理与应用技术 相关资料

插图:3)码(Key):唯一标识实体的属性集称为码。例如,学生的学号可以作为学生实体的码,学生的姓名则不一定能作为学生实体的码,因为姓名是可以重复的。而选修情况则把学号和课程号的组合作为码。4)域(Domain):属性的取值范围称为该属性的域。如学生的性别只能取“男”或者“女”,成绩的域为0~100的整数等。5)实体型(Entity Type):具有相同属性的实体必然具有共同的特征和性质。用实体名及其属性名集合来抽象和刻画同类实体,称为实体型。例如,学生(学号、姓名、性别、出生日期、所在系、专业、所在班、特长、家庭住址),课程(课程号、课程名、授课学期、学分、课程性质),学生选课(学号、课程号、修课类型、修课时间、成绩)。6)实体集(Entity Set):同型实体的集合称为实体集。例如,所有的学生、所有的课程、所有的选课情况。7)联系(Relationship):在信息世界中,事物的联系反映为实体内部的联系和实体之间的联系。实体内部的联系通常是指组成实体的各属性之间的联系。实体之间的联系通常是指不同实体之间的联系。例如,在职工实体中,假设有职工号、姓名、部门经理号等属性,其中部门经理号描述的是管理这个部门职工的部门经理的编号,通常部门经理也是职工,因此部门经理号与职工号之间有一种关联约束的关系,即部门经理号的取值受职工号取值的限制,这是实体内部的联系。再比如,学生选课实体和学生基本信息实体之间也有联系,这个联系是学生选课实体中的学号必须是学生基本信息实体中已经存在的学号,即不允许存在没有学生记录的学生选课,这就是实体之间的联系。这里主要讨论实体之间的联系。两个实体型之间的联系可以分为三类: 一对一联系(1:1)。如果对于实体集A中的每一个实体,实体集B中至多有n个实体与之联系,反之亦然,则称实体集A与实体集B具有一对一联系,记为1:1。例如,部门和正经理(假设一个部门只有一个正经理,一个人只当一个部门的经理)、系和正系主任(假设一个系只有一个正主任,一个人只当一个系的主任)都是一对一联系。 一对多联系(1:n)。如果对于实体集A中的每一个实体,实体集B中有n(n≥0)个实体与之联系,反之,对于实体集B中的每一个实体,实体集A中至多只有一个实体与之联系,则称实体集A与实体集B具有一对多联系,记为1:n。例如,一个部门可以

商品评论(0条)
暂无评论……
书友推荐
编辑推荐
返回顶部
中图网
在线客服